Subject Introduction of the outcomes of MEPC 53 Technical Information No. TEC-0638 Date 14 September 2005 To whom it may concern This is a summary report of the decisions and discussions taken at the fifty-third session of the Marine Environment Protection Committee (MEPC 53) held on 18 - 22 July 2005. 1. Adoption of Mandatory InstrumentsMARPOL 73/38 (1) Relating Regulation 13(G), Revised MARPOL ANNEX I - Condition Assessment Scheme (CAS) - (refer to Attachment 1) It was adopted the amendments to the Condition Assessment Scheme (CAS) for the purpose of bringing its cross-references to the regulations under MARPOL Annex I in line with the new numbering system in the revised MARPOL Annex I which adopted at MEPC 52 after its entry into force (1 January 2007). (2) Relating MARPOL ANNEX VI and the NOx Technical Code (refer to Attachment 2) The following amendments of MARPOL ANNEX VI and the NOx Technical Code were adopted at this session and will enter into force on 22 November 2006. The contents of these amendments are follows. (i) Regulation 2 – Definition In addition to the definition, regulation 2 of this ANNEX, the definition of anniversary date was added in order to introduce the HSSC. (ii) Regulation 5 – Surveys The title of this regulation was changed to “Surveys” from “Surveys and inspection”. In order to introduce the HSSC, there are specified for each survey (annual, intermediate and renewal survey). (iii) Regulation 6 – Issue or Endorsement of International Air Pollution Prevention Certificate The title of this regulation was changed to “Issue or Endorsement of International Air Pollution Prevention Certificate” from “Issue of International Air Pollution Prevention Certificate”. In order to introduce the HSSC, there are specified for each certification and endorsement. (iv) Regulation 7 – Issue or Endorsement of a Certificate by another Government The title of this regulation was changed to “Issue or Endorsement of a Certificate by another Government” from “Issue of a Certificate by another Government” In order to introduce the HSSC, there are specified for each certification and endorsement.     GUIDELINES FOR PORT STATE CONTROL UNDER MARPOL ANNEX VI Chapter 1 GENERAL 1.1 This document is intended to provide basic guidance on the conduct of port State control inspections for compliance with MARPOL Annex VI (hereinafter referred to as “the Annex”) and afford consistency in the conduct of these inspections, the recognition of deficiencies and the application of control procedures. 1.2 The regulations of MARPOL Annex VI contain the following compliance provisions:

    .1 an IAPP Certificate is required for all ships of 400 GT or above engaged in international voyages. Administrations may establish alternative appropriate measures to demonstrate the necessary compliance in respect of ships under 400 GT engaged in international voyages;

    .2 in the case of the NOx controls, these apply to all diesel engines over 130 kW

    (other than those used solely for emergency purposes) installed on ships constructed on or after 1 January 2000, and diesel engines subject to ‘major conversion’ (as defined by the Annex) on or after that date;

    .3 only those incinerators installed on or after 1 January 2000 are required to comply

    with the associated requirements (appendix IV to the Annex), however, the restrictions as to which materials may be incinerated apply to all incinerators; and

    .4 tanker vapour emission control systems are only required where their fitting is

    specified by the relevant authority.

    1.3 Chapters 1 (General), 4 (Contravention and detention), 5 (Reporting requirements) and 6 (Review procedures) of the Procedures for Port State Control adopted by resolution A.787(19), as amended by resolution A.882(21), also apply to these Guidelines.     MARPOL ANNEX VI, REGULATION 14(4)(b) INTRODUCTION Regulation 14(4) of Annex VI to MARPOL 73/78 requires ships within SOx emission control areas to either use fuel oil with a sulphur content not exceeding 1.5% or apply an exhaust gas (SOx) cleaning system (EGCS-SOx) to reduce the total emission of SOx to 6.0g/kWh. (6.0 g SOx/kWh or less should be calculated as the total weight of sulphur dioxide emission). The EGCS-SOx unit is to be approved by the Administration taking into account guidelines developed by the Organization. Similar to a NOx emission reduction system, a EGCS-SOx unit may be type approved subject to periodic parameter and emission checks or the system may be equipped with a continuous emission monitoring system. These guidelines have been developed with the intention of being objective and performance oriented. Introduction of the SO2 (ppm) / CO2 (%) ratio method would simplify the monitoring of SOx emission and facilitate type approval of the EGCS-SOx unit. See Appendix I for the rationale explaining the use of SO2 (ppm) / CO2 (%) as the basis for system monitoring. These Guidelines are recommendatory in nature, however, Administrations are invited to base their implementation on these guidelines. SAFETY NOTE Due attention is to be given to the safety implications related to the handling and proximity of exhaust gases, the measurement equipment and the storage and use of cylindered pure and calibration gases. Sampling positions and access staging should be such that this monitoring may be performed safely. In locating discharge outlet of waste water used in the EGCS-SOx unit, due consideration should be given to the location of the ship's sea water inlet and other implications of the acidic nature of such water.
